I have a 2004 Rav 4 headunit that I want to install into my 4 speaker system. What will I need to make it work. Should I pick up an amp from a stock celi or should I see if the Ravs came stock with an amp and use that?

Sorry, sound systems are not my thing.

how does it look from the back? Depends if whether 15 pin or 20 pin. If 20 pin, you need same year amp or create a hybrid harness. Now IIRC the 2004 rav 4 may measure 7.4 inches across, our units are 7 inches accross, you may have to modify you bezel
